Location Of Control Modules On The Most Network

NOTE:

The control modules on the MOST network should be positioned in a particular order. If this order is not followed, the fault-tracing of the MOST network will deteriorate.

When a control module is added to the MOST network, it should be placed in the correct order on the network to make it easier to fault-trace the control modules.

If the control modules are connected in another order, this does not effect the function of the MOST network, but fault-tracing will be more difficult.

The control modules should be placed in the following order: 

  1. Infotainment control module (ICM)
  2. Multimedia module (MMM)
  3. Remote Digital Audio Receiver (RDAR)
  4. Audio module (AUD)
  5. Phone module (PHM)/ Bluetooth phone module (BPM)
  6. Integrated Audio Module (IAM)
  7. Accessory USB unit (AUU)
